Today, on 12 June in Elvis History

-
1956
-
Elvis and June Juanico flew to Houston to pick up the new convertible Elvis had ordered.
-
1957
-
Elvis shipped a wallaby, which was given to him as a gift, from Australia to the Memphis Zoo.
-
1962
-
Elvis posed for publicity stills for the picture.
-
1964
-
Elvis didn't report at the arranged session time of 7:00 p.m. and the band was dismissed at 10:40 p.m. after completing several backing tracks.
-
1966
-
Finally Elvis reported to the studio where he spent very little time on the vocals although the songs obviously meant a lot to him; Indescribably Blue, I'll Remember You and If Every Day Was Like Christmas.
-
1971
-
Back home in Memphis Elvis spent time at Kang Rhee's studio.
-
1972
-
Elvis performed at the Memorial Coliseum, Fort Wayne, Indiana.
